Religion provides a belief system, moral framework, and practices for its followers to connect with the divine or achieve spiritual fulfillment. It often includes rituals, teachings, and scriptures that guide adherents in understanding the meaning of life, the universe, and their place in it. Different religions have distinct traditions, structures, and interpretations of the divine that shape the beliefs and practices of their followers.

There is no national religion on Antarctica, because there are no countries there. People who practice every religion on earth may, however, live and work there temporarily.
